Penny I just got a couple of heating pads from Walmart they aren't very big 12"x15" do you just lay one in the brooder? and it has 3 settings low, med and high do you use low setting?
When using the heating pad method, it's best to have the pad draped over some sort of frame. I use a piece of wire fencing. Sturdy enough for chicks to play on top of, but flexible enough to easily adjust as they grow. I use a puppy pad on top to keep poop off the pad. Chicks need to be able to make contact with the pad to warm themselves. Start with the highest setting and watch the chicks. If they aren't spending any time under or sitting on top of it more than they are under it, it's too warm.
